New Interview with Peter Facinelli
IESB has an awesome new interview entitled "Exclusive Interview: From New Moon to Nurse Jackie with Peter Facinelli"
IESB: What initially attracted you to acting? Was there someone or something that inspired you to do it, or did you just know that you wanted to be a performer?
Peter: No, I was the opposite of a performer. I was really shy, when I was growing up. I saw a movie called Butch Cassidy and the Sundance Kid in third grade, and I thought Paul Newman and Robert Redford looked like they were having a really good time, and I said, "That's what I want to do, when I grow up." I always was inspired by Paul Newman and Robert Redford to want to be an actor, but I never really did anything about it because I was shy. So, all through high school, I never did a play.
Not until college, did I start to do acting. I transferred into NYU from St. John's University and started studying theater. I was going to take law because it seemed to impress people in my family when I said, "I want to be a lawyer when I grow up." One time, I told them that I wanted to be an actor and they all looked at me like I had five heads. The next time they asked me what I wanted to be, I said, "A lawyer," and I got a lot of oohs and aahs in the family. When you watch movies and you watch Law & Order, it looks so interesting."

Rosalie's Fiance Cast in Eclipse

Hollywood Reporter is reporting that actor Jack Hudson has been cast to play Rosalie's fiance Royce King in "The Twilight Saga: New Moon"!
"The actor joins Robert Pattinson, Kristen Stewart and Bryce Dallas Howard in the third installment of the vampire series derived from Stephenie Meyer's novels. Huston will play Royce King II, a human that lived during the Great Depression."
"Huston, repped by ICM, the Collective and U.K.-based Finch & Partners, stars on the ABC series "Eastwick," which debuts next month. He next appears in the features "Boogie Woogie" and "Mr. Nice," and he appeared in "Shrink," which recently opened in limited release."

Twilight Wins 11 Teen Choice Awards
The Teen Choice Awards aired last night, with Twilight bringing in 11 of the 12 awards it was nominated for!So why didn't twilight win 12/12? Because Nikki Read and Ashley Greene were nominated in the same category! So basically - Twilight won everything it was nominated for!
Here are the winners from Twilight:
-Choice Movie Drama: "Twilight."
-Choice Movie Actor Drama: Robert Pattinson, "Twilight."
-Choice Movie Actress Drama: Kristen Stewart, "Twilight.
-Choice Movie Villain: Cam Gigandet, "Twilight."
-Choice Movie Fresh Face Female: Ashley Greene, "Twilight."
-Choice Movie Fresh Face Male: Taylor Lautner, "Twilight."
-Choice Movie Liplock: Kristen Stewart and Robert Pattinson, "Twilight."
-Choice Movie Rumble: Robert Pattinson vs. Cam Gigandet, "Twilight."
-Choice Music Soundtrack: "Twilight."
